  • Name: Inotilone
  • Chemical Name: 2-[(3,4-dihydroxyphenyl)methylidene]-5-methylfuran-3-one
  • CAS Number: 906366-79-8
  • Molecular Formula: C12H10O4
  • Molecular Weight: 218.21
  • Catalog: Signaling Pathways Metabolic Enzyme/Protease MMP
  • Create Date: 2016-12-25 16:04:14
  • Modify Date: 2024-01-03 14:55:19
  • Inotilone is an inhibitor of matrix metalloproteinase MMP-2 and MMP-9, to against metastatic in lung cancer cells. Inotilone enhances the activity of the antioxidant enzymes to support its anti-metastatic activity. Inotilone also inhibits IκBα phosphorylation and NFκB p65 nuclear translocation, involving in FAK, PI3K/AKT, MAPKs and NFκB pathways[1].
